The shrinkray CLI lets plugins submit batch image-resize jobs to the Tessera processing service. Plugins invoke shrinkray with a manifest of source paths and target dimensions; output is written to the staging bucket. All requests are authenticated against the internal gateway. For sandbox development, authenticate using the shared plugin-sandbox key, which follows below.

app token of tagef-tafog = qvz3-7n0

Subject: Inkwell markdown pipeline 5.1 deployed

On-call: the Inkwell rendering pipeline is now on 5.1 in production. Changes: sanitizer runs before the table parser, footnote rendering is cached per document, and the fallback plain-text path no longer strips headings. If render latency alarms fire, roll back via the standard script — it handles cache invalidation. Known issue: nested blockquotes over six levels render flat. The deployment trace token follows.

build token for hawep-kageg: htk14_558814e2114cc7

Subject: On-call notes — websocket compression

Quick context before your first shift. Murkwater's gateway uses permessage-deflate with per-connection contexts; that saves bandwidth but memory scales with connection count. If the fleet alarms on RSS, the usual fix is lowering the compression window, not disabling it outright — disabling spikes egress costs fast. Tradeoff matrix, safe parameter ranges, and the rollback command are on the internal page below.

operations page: https://vault.qorvelcorp.example/settings

Subject: Autocomplete index cut-over complete

The slow autocomplete index on Quillsearch has been cut over to the rebuilt shard set as of tonight. Query latency dropped from ~900ms to under 80ms in staging and prod. Old index stays read-only for a week, then gets dropped. If anything pages overnight, check against the current service configuration below.

service settings:
[quenath]
host = quenath.zemvarcorp.corp
user = quenath_svc
database = quenath_prod